Lab Petri dishes are fundamental tools in various scientific disciplines, primarily used for culturing microorganisms, cell growth, and conducting small-scale experiments. Their applications range from educational school science projects to sophisticated bioresearch and medical diagnostics. Lid Design: Vented vs. Unvented

The design of the petri dish lid significantly impacts gas exchange and condensation. Unvented lids, common in many standard packs like those from LabAider, create a more sealed environment, which is suitable for anaerobic cultures or applications where moisture retention is critical. Conversely, dishes featuring vented lids, such as the "3 Vented Lids" on Vabiooth plates, facilitate improved air circulation. This feature is particularly beneficial for aerobic cultures, as it helps prevent excessive condensation build-up on the lid, which can drip onto the agar surface and interfere with growth patterns or cause contamination.

Frequently Asked Questions

What is the primary difference between vented and unvented petri dish lids?
Vented lids, like those found on Vabiooth dishes, have small ridges or openings that allow for gas exchange, which is beneficial for aerobic cultures and reduces condensation. Unvented lids create a more sealed environment, suitable for anaerobic cultures or when moisture retention is critical.
Are all plastic petri dishes reusable after sterilization?
Generally, plastic petri dishes are designed for single-use, especially after culturing biological samples, to maintain sterility and prevent cross-contamination. While some might attempt to re-sterilize, their integrity and optical clarity can degrade, and they may not achieve the same level of sterility as new, factory-sterilized products.

Can I use standard plastic petri dishes for high-temperature applications?
Most standard plastic petri dishes, typically made of polystyrene, are not designed for high-temperature applications like autoclaving. High heat can cause them to melt or deform. For applications requiring heat sterilization or high temperatures, specialized glass petri dishes are typically used.
